Might and September have extremely good climate and somewhat reduced crowds. London in December is enchanting, with Xmas lights and markets and a very joyful vibe in the city. In spring, temperatures increase, the skies begin to clear, and rainfall opportunities drop. The typical high temperature in March is

12C(53F)however this increases to 19C (67F)by the end of May. The typical high temperature is 23C (73F), but during warm front it can get much warmer than this. In recent times, London has actually seen temperature levels get to 38C (100F ). Loss is the opposite of spring. Temperatures cool down and rainfall possibilities enhance. The average high ranges from 19C (67F) to 12C( 53F) and October is among the rainiest months of the year, with 9 days of rainfall. The ordinary high temperature is 9C(48F)and the average low is 4C (40F). Rainfall drops concerning 8 or 9 days a month, making winter months among the wettest times to visit London.
Snowfall is read rare, yet when it happens, it's enchanting. We were fortunate to experience London with a cleaning of snow on our most recent go to.
